8 Creative Dishes   One Can Make With Tomatoes    

White Line

1. Caprese Salad Skewers  

White Line

Create bite-sized appetizers by skewering cherry tomatoes, fresh mozzarella balls, and basil leaves. Drizzle with balsamic glaze and olive oil for a simple and elegant Caprese salad on a stick. 

2. Stuffed Tomatoes 

White Line

Hollow out large tomatoes and stuff them with a flavorful mixture of couscous, herbs, and diced vegetables. Bake until the tomatoes are tender and the filling is cooked to perfection. 

3. Tomato Basil Bruschetta 

White Line

Whip up a classic bruschetta by combining diced tomatoes with fresh basil, garlic, and olive oil. Serve this mixture on toasted slices of baguette for a delicious appetizer or snack. 

4. Tomato and Roasted Red Pepper Soup 

White Line

Create a comforting soup by blending tomatoes with roasted red peppers, garlic, and onions. Add some broth, seasonings, and a touch of cream for a rich and flavorful tomato soup. 

5. Tomato and Goat Cheese Tart 

White Line

Make a savory tart by layering sliced tomatoes and goat cheese on a puff pastry sheet. Bake until the pastry is golden brown, and the tomatoes are roasted. Garnish with fresh herbs for an impressive dish. 

6. Tomato Salsa with a Twist 

White Line

Upgrade your traditional salsa by incorporating unique ingredients like mango, avocado, or black beans with diced tomatoes. Serve with tortilla chips for a refreshing and flavorful dip. 

7. Tomato and Spinach Stuffed Chicken Breast 

White Line

Roll up chicken breasts with a filling made from diced tomatoes, sautéed spinach, and feta cheese. Bake until the chicken is cooked through, creating a juicy and flavorful main course. 

8. Tomato Jam 

White Line

Transform tomatoes into a sweet and tangy jam by cooking them down with sugar, vinegar, and spices. This versatile condiment can be used as a spread for toast, a topping for burgers, or a glaze for grilled meats.
